Dr Alison Plaut, in Be More: 18 practical steps for more peace, success, and happiness in YOUR life…beginning today! describes the divine nature within every woman as a source of love, strength, and compassion—an inner power that brings harmony and healing.

 

In various spiritual traditions, including the Vedic tradition, this essence is personified as Shakti. Shakti is the goddess of strength, protection, and creativity. Just as Mother Earth provides sustenance and shelter for all life, Shakti and women, in essence, have a natural ability to nourish those around them.

 

Plaut argues that understanding and embracing this divine aspect of femininity is essential for individual women and society as a whole. Just as a woman holds the balance of this world by becoming a mother and a protector for her child—honoring women’s unique qualities allows them to contribute fully to their families, communities, and the world, creating environments where love and respect thrive.

 

Dr. Plaut also acknowledges the efforts made toward achieving gender equality. She invites us to see beyond societal labels and roles and explains that women’s power is not simply about equality with men. Instead, it is about recognizing and valuing the qualities that make women unique and special. This divine power lies in the ability to create, unify, and heal, qualities that are often overlooked in modern discussions of empowerment.

 

For Plaut, true empowerment goes beyond conventional definitions. When each woman embraces her unique capabilities and knows that her contributions, whether at home, in the workplace, or in the community, are invaluable, she is in a better position to honor her inner strengths and can transform not only their lives but also the lives of those around them.

 

Plaut also delves into the concept of masculine and feminine energies. The masculine principle is analytical and decisive, while the feminine principle is nurturing and inclusive. Balancing these energies is crucial for us to keep harmony and growth. For Plaut, every individual, regardless of gender, benefits from honoring both these aspects, but she emphasizes that society especially benefits when women’s natural nurturing power is fully expressed, respected, and supported. .

 

In her view, a world that appreciates and cultivates feminine qualities alongside masculine ones will be more good. Be it by creating healthier relationships, more compassionate communities, or a more peaceful society—where both women and men can live in harmony, secure, and loved— this nurturing energy plays a vital role in guiding society toward a balanced and harmonious state.

 

Plaut highlights the role of women as protectors of life. Drawing from ancient cultural traditions that celebrate the sacred feminine, including Vedic, Mayan, and Egyptian cultures, she demonstrates the power of women as central to the well-being of the family and community. Plaut believes that reclaiming this sacred role enables women to bring about positive change in the world without force, simply by embodying their authentic selves.

 

In short, in a world where many traditions, localities, cultures, and minorities frequently criticize women and their roles, Dr Alison Plaut’s “Be More” celebrates women’s divine nature while encouraging them to embrace their unique inner power.

 

This power, rooted in love, compassion, empathy, and resilience, is transformative for women and everyone they touch. By honoring and cultivating this divine quality, women can lead society toward greater harmony and fulfillment, creating a world where the feminine principle is valued and cherished as essential to all aspects of life.
